CONTROLLING HEIFER FEED COST WITHOUT COMPROMISE

Feed costs are at an all-time high and feeding replacement heifers presents cost challenges. The largest dedicated dairy heifer replacement research facility in the world has some proven cost-saving information to share with you. During this webinar session, you will explore feed cost control research being done at the University of Wisconsin Integrated Dairy Heifer Research Facility located at the Marshfield Agricultural Research Station. Follow the research crew as they limit feed 72 pens of heifers, utilize tropical corn, evaluate eastern Gamagrass, and manage dry matter intake of dairy heifers. MANAGING DAIRY HEIFERS IN THE AGE OF GENOMICS

Commercial genomics for dairy heifers has come of age in the last two years. The University of Wisconsin-Madison Integrated Dairy Research Facility has managed a full genomics program over these past two years. Their valuable results bring to light both the challenges and advantages of managing dairy heifer genomics. DAIRY HEIFER MANAGEMENT: PITFALLS AND PARADIGMS

Should dairy heifers be bred by body weight? Does better management equal earlier, more optimal ages at first calving? Do younger heifers really produce more lifetime milk? Are you sure? Many of the old "rules-of-thumb" for dairy heifer management are not proven by today's research. Some are. This webinar will separate fact from fiction when it comes to common dairy heifer benchmarks. You might be surprised by the facts!
